PM Modi touches Constitution book to forehead upon his arrival at Sanvidhan Sabha – World News Network

New Delhi [India], June 7 (ANI): Prime Minister Narendra Modi bowed and respectfully touched the Constitution of India with his forehead after he entered the Sanvidhan Sabha (Centre hall of Parliament) on Friday to attend the NDA meeting.
Prime Minister was seen wearing a white kurta, and churidar with a cream colour half jacket.
PM Modi humbly greeted the newly elected MPs with folded hands and met the NDA allies’ partners.
In the meeting held at the Samvidhan Sadan of the Parliament building, the Prime Minister was welcomed with chants of ‘Modi Modi’.
BJP MP-elect Nitin Gadkari, JD(S) MP-elect HD Kumaraswamy, Lok Janshakti Party (Ram Vilas) National President Chirag Paswan, Maharashtra Deputy CM and NCP chief Ajit Pawar, HAM(S) founder Jitan Ram Manjhi were among others who supported the proposal.
PM Modi and LJP (Ram Vilas) chief Chirag Paswan also shared a candid moment at the NDA Parliamentary Party meeting. Chirag Paswas hugged the Prime Minister and Chirag got the PM’s pat of appreciation.
Earlier today, Prime Minister Modi-led NDA staked a claim for government formation. PM Modi arrived at the Rashtrapati Bhavan and President Droupadi Murmu over the NDA government formation.
Earlier this week, leaders of parties in the NDA held a meeting and passed a resolution to elect Prime Minister Narendra Modi as their leader.
According to sources, Narendra Modi is likely to take oath as the Prime Minister for the third consecutive time on June 9.
According to the results announced by the Election Commission of India on Tuesday, the BJP won 240 seats and along with its allies, it stands at 293 seats. Chandrababu Naidu’s TDP and Nitish Kumar’s JDU, having won 16 and 12 seats respectively in their respective states, have extended support to the NDA. (ANI)
